Summary:

Lead our revenue management team and oversee all aspects of revenue optimizationDevelop and implement pricing strategies to maximize revenue and profitabilityAnalyze market trends and competitor data to identify opportunities and make informed pricing decisionsUtilize revenue management systems and tools to forecast demand and optimize inventoryCollaborate with sales and marketing teams to develop targeted promotions and packagesMonitor and evaluate revenue performance and adjust strategies as neededConduct regular revenue meetings and provide guidance to the teamStay up-to-date with industry trends and best practices to drive continuous improvement

Qualifications •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ent experience.• 3 years+ years experience in Revenue Management position. • Previous supervisory/managerial experience. • Ability to effectively communicate verbally and in written form with the public as well as other team members.• Strong understanding of hotel sales and hotel distribution sources and strategies.• Experience with major Hospitality Sales CRM systems.• Essential statistical and analytical skills required to identify revenue opportunities and shortfalls.• Ability to work both independently and cross-functionally to achieve goals.• Ability to thrive in a multi-tasked and fast-paced environment.• Present a professional and confident appearance.
